TLS/SSL协议是网络安全的重要支柱,它们为网络通信提供了加密和身份验证服务。通过深入解析这两种协议,我们可以更好地理解它们的工作原理和如何保护我们的网络安全。无论是在浏览网页、发送电子邮件还是在进行在线交易时,TLS/SSL都在默默地守护着我们的网络安全。
本文目录导读:
在当今这个高度依赖网络的时代,网络安全已经成为了一个不容忽视的问题,为了保护数据的安全传输,TLS/SSL协议应运而生,作为一名主机评测专家,我将为大家详细介绍TLS/SSL协议的工作原理、优势以及在实际应用中的表现。
TLS/SSL协议简介
TLS(Transport Layer Security,传输层安全)和SSL(Secure Sockets Layer,安全套接层)协议是两种用于在客户端和服务器之间建立加密通信通道的安全协议,它们的主要目的是确保数据在传输过程中的安全性,防止被窃取、篡改或伪造,TLS协议是SSL协议的继任者,它们之间存在许多相似之处,但也存在一些差异。
TLS/SSL协议的工作原理
1、握手过程
TLS/SSL协议的握手过程分为四个阶段,分别是:客户端hello、服务器hello、客户端完成和服务器完成,在这个过程中,客户端和服务器会交换一系列信息,以确认彼此的身份并建立加密通信通道。
2、密钥交换
在握手过程中,客户端和服务器会协商生成一个共享密钥,这个密钥将用于后续的加密和解密操作,TLS/SSL协议支持多种密钥交换算法,如RSA、Diffie-Hellman等。
3、加密与解密
在握手过程完成后,客户端和服务器将使用协商好的密钥对数据进行加密和解密,这样,即使数据在传输过程中被截获,攻击者也无法读取其中的内容。
TLS/SSL协议的优势
1、安全性
TLS/SSL协议采用了多种加密算法和密钥交换机制,能够有效地保护数据的安全传输,它还支持证书验证,可以确保客户端和服务器之间的身份真实性。
2、兼容性
TLS/SSL协议已经成为了互联网领域的通用安全标准,几乎所有的主流浏览器和服务器都支持TLS/SSL协议,因此它具有良好的兼容性。
3、扩展性
TLS/SSL协议支持多种扩展,可以根据不同的应用场景提供定制化的安全解决方案,它可以实现双向认证、前向保密等功能。
TLS/SSL协议在实际应用中的表现
在实际应用场景中,TLS/SSL协议已经得到了广泛的应用,以下是一些典型的应用案例:
1、网站安全
许多网站都使用了TLS/SSL协议来保护用户的数据安全,当用户访问这些网站时,浏览器会自动检查网站的证书,以确保其安全性,只有通过验证的网站才能建立安全的加密通信通道。
2、电子邮件安全
TLS/SSL协议也被广泛应用于电子邮件领域,通过使用TLS/SSL协议,电子邮件可以在传输过程中进行加密,从而保护用户隐私。
3、文件传输
在一些需要传输敏感文件的场景中,TLS/SSL协议也发挥着重要作用,许多企业都使用TLS/SSL协议来保护内部文件的传输安全。
4、VPN服务
虚拟专用网络(VPN)是一种通过公共网络建立安全通信通道的技术,TLS/SSL协议在VPN服务中扮演着关键角色,它确保了VPN连接的安全性和稳定性。
作为网络安全的守护者,TLS/SSL协议在保护数据安全传输方面发挥着重要作用,通过了解TLS/SSL协议的工作原理、优势以及在实际应用中的表现,我们可以更好地认识到它在网络安全领域的重要性,随着网络技术的发展,TLS/SSL协议将继续发挥其作用,为我们的网络生活提供安全保障。
我们也应该看到,TLS/SSL协议并非万能的,在某些情况下,它仍然可能面临一些安全挑战,如中间人攻击、证书伪造等,我们需要不断地更新和完善TLS/SSL协议,以应对日益严峻的网络安全形势。
作为一名主机评测专家,我将继续关注TLS/SSL协议的发展,为大家提供更多关于网络安全方面的知识和建议,我也希望大家能够重视网络安全问题,共同维护一个安全、健康的网络环境。